  • Abstract
    Upcoming applications like VoIP or multimedia telephony in cellular networks require support of quality of service (QoS) in the radio access network (RAN). Cellular network providers who want to offer QoS based services have to plan their network capacity according to user demands. Therefore, the integration of a traffic simulator into the dimensioning tools becomes one of the most important aspects for the QoS support during the network dimensioning process. This article describes a generalized solution for packet traffic simulation (TSim) in cellular networks, which is carried out looking forward the interoperability that fourth generation (4G) wireless network promises to offer. The traffic simulator is performed and tested for EDGE and WiMAX systems. In addition, TSim extensions for UMTS and HSDPA are discussed. TSim simulates the overall traffic in a cell with the scope to evaluate the individual traffic flow QoS performance within a given RAN hardware capacity.
